After graduation in Bachelor of arts, can I give UPSC exam and simultaneously pursue 3 year llb course?

Yes, absolutely you can.

The minimum educational qualification required for giving UPSC exam is Bachelor degree. If you're 21 years and have graduated the you're are eligible to give this exam.

Regarding the BA. Llb degree, you can still pursue it while preparing for UPSC. This will not hamper your opportunity to become an IAS.
